Transaction 61ae0490d62a0039535f0a7e20a9091e4fb0b08f1ed4dfbc46edda08752bb3cc

1 Input
2 Outputs
  • 61ae0490d62a0039535f0a7e20a9091e4fb0b08f1ed4dfbc46edda08752bb3cc:0
  • value  2930941083
    address  347K6feTTYcrBWCBSgZVV6puWTrasjDfbp
  • 61ae0490d62a0039535f0a7e20a9091e4fb0b08f1ed4dfbc46edda08752bb3cc:1
  • value  99993
    address  3AsRmi88vNEGjwY5VRMXRhKFyHZynE6U9z